The Bright Glam Look
Bright colors are everywhere. Most styles incorporating a serious pop of color will focus on just one area: Either the eyes or the lips. Doing both can be a bit of overkill.
If you’re going for the eyes, consider using more than one color. The “watercolor” shadow look has delicate splashes of pigment being scattered on the lid in a haphazard pattern that extends out even as high as the eyebrows. Pair with this a neon or brightly pigmented eyeliner and mascara that will be sure to attract attention!
The Natural Skin and No (or Little) Makeup Look
The “no makeup” look certainly isn’t new, but actually not wearing makeup is.
The key to this natural trend is focusing on improving skincare so much that makeup is not needed. Instead of just covering up imperfections with thick foundation and concealer, an esthetician can help you find the right skincare routine to make your own skin flawless.
There are other opportunities to forego the need for makeup as well: Things like permanent eyeliner, eyebrow manicuring and microblading services, and eyelash extensions.
The 90s Grunge Simple Look
So, you like the idea of subdued makeup, but you can’t quite let go of that concealer and eyeshadow. That’s okay.
The 90s grunge simple look may be for you.
Back in the 90s, there were still some hangers-on from the 80s who reveled in blue eyeliner and bright coral lips. Other youngsters liked crimped hair, butterfly clips, and frosted eyeshadow. But many people were simultaneously entering another world — a world of dark lipsticks, kohl-rimmed eyes, and black choker necklaces.
This latter look is coming back in a major way. We’re seeing it on celebs like Kim Kardashian, Bella Hadid, and others. If you want to achieve it for yourself, think hair scrunchies, small-framed sunglasses, layered necklaces, hoop earrings, and of course, dark lipstick and thick eyeliner.
